LdapDirectoryIdentifier Class
.NET Framework 4.5
The LdapDirectoryIdentifier class creates a directory identifier for one or more LDAP servers.

| Name | Description | |
|---|---|---|
![]() | Connectionless | The Connectionless property specifies that the connection is User Datagram Protocol (UDP). |
![]() | FullyQualifiedDnsHostName | The FullyQualifiedDnsHostName property specifies that a server name is a fully-qualified DNS host name. |
![]() | PortNumber | The PortNumber property contains the portnumber to be used to connect to the server. |
![]() | Servers | The Servers property contains the set of servers this object identifies. |
